Simple. Just flick a switch. What about when the light is out in the eyes of a heroic 12 year old girl? That\u2019s much harder. But that\u2019s what Ezer Mizion is there for and, once again, the Linked to Life network rallied and the light went on. 1000 watts! She had been battling cancer for what seemed to her and her family to be eons. They handled each problem as it came with  trust in G-d. Some were harder than others. Recently it became necessary for this young child to have her leg amputated. They understood. It would save her life. But it was so hard. To think of her living for the rest of her life &#8211; may it be many, many years \u2013 missing a leg! While still in the throes of dealing with this devastating catastrophe, the calendar informed them that her bas mitzvah had arrived. The prime ingredient of a celebration is smiles. And, at this time, there were none to be had. That\u2019s when the Ezer Mizion <a href=\"https:\/\/ezermizion.org\/blog\/the-number-that-everyone-knows\/\">Linked to Life<\/a> network was informed and a post went out. \u201cToday we are going to restore light to the girl&#8217;s eyes. Today, she will go to sleep happy and content\u2026 with a wide smile, and will wake up with a lot of strength to keep going.\u201d And then it began to pour. Her home was flooded. A stunning Bas Mitzvah cake. Goodies galore. Balloons with grinning emojis and encouraging messages. Gifts and gifts and more gifts. It was a major storm of caring and support. And suddenly the smiles abounded. They\u2019d make it through. Like any other17 year old girl, she has dreams. It\u2019s so hard to hold onto dreams when so many of her days are spent in a hospital setting but Yael doesn\u2019t give up. She studies hard for her matriculation exams. Some days giggling with a friend and some days attached to an IV pole. She is determined, our Yael. Determined to have the best possible future. And in her busy life, she makes a place for fun also. <a href=\"https:\/\/ezermizion.org\/blog\/cancer-support-with-a-vro-o-o-m\/\">Meir Odesser <\/a>is one of those talented people who can bring joy to the most depressed. He comes regularly to Ezer Mizion and puts on a fantastic show of twisting balloons into animals and the like.\u00a0 Yael loves the show but she wants more. She wants to learn how to do it herself. Meir was thrilled to bring added happiness to this special girl and spends hours giving lessons and, most importantly, blowing a surge of optimism into each and every
